How To Get A Good Nights Sleep

Health And Fitness : Top Health Tips

It's a worrying fact that in the UK, 58% of us have a minimum of 1 bad night's sleep a week, and 18% have insufficient sleep most nights.

Causes for poor sleep include worrying about something or being unable to switch off, drinking too much caffeine or alcohol, eating late, going to bed on an empty stomach, strenuous exercise in the evening, and sharing a bed with a snorer.

Ensure you dont drink much 2-3 hours before you go to bed, then you wont have to get up in the middle of the night. Also make sure your room is cool, but with a warm bed. Sleep in a separate room if your partner disturbs you.

Try to relax in the evening, maybe by reading a book or having a warm shower. Make a list of everything you have to do tomorrow so you dont need to try and remember it. Switch off your phone and computer. Turn off all the lights and set your alarm for the next morning if you need to get up early. Set 2 alarms 5 minutes apart if you are worried you will get up and switch it off, then go back to bed.
